## Fleet Fuel Report — Onboarding

Welcome to the Haulpine telemetry team. The weekly fuel-usage report aggregates pump readings from every depot tractor and reconciles them against odometer deltas. Before you can regenerate a failed report, you must unlock the reconciliation service with the shared recovery passphrase. Treat it as sensitive and never paste it into chat. For reference during onboarding, the passphrase appears below.

recovery phrase for faduf-hawep: casix-gilox

Reviewers approving changes to the Findwell autocomplete service should know the break-glass path, since the index is notoriously slow to rebuild and emergencies are time-sensitive. If the prefix-trie shards stop serving and the admin API is unresponsive, do not trigger a full rebuild; that takes hours. Instead, attach to the maintenance port on the primary shard host and request elevated access. The maintenance daemon validates intent with a challenge prompt. At that prompt, provide the recovery passphrase listed immediately below.

recovery phrase for fajeg-hagug: holox-fenmir

## Shrinking telemetry payloads

If the Bramblewire ingest queue starts backing up, flip on payload compression before you scale anything. Zstd at level 3 is the sweet spot — higher levels just burn CPU for maybe 2% savings. Restart the collector after changing anything. The settings that worked during the last incident are listed here.

service settings:
[casax]
port = 6379
team = rusir
host = casax.zemvarhq.corp
region = outer-4
access_code = ac_9808ce
timeout_ms = 1500

Welcome aboard. For the Tornquist ledger service we never run destructive migrations in one step: add the new column, dual-write, backfill in batches, flip reads, then drop the old column in a later release. Backfills run through the Saffold job runner so they can be paused mid-flight. Keep batch sizes small enough that replication lag stays under our alerting threshold. The batch and throttle constants currently in production are listed below.

tuning table, kajog-bawip:
TIERS = {
    "kelius": 256,
    "lammir": 543,
}